Get that cork outta here
This gadget looks space age and will extract a cork as advertised. That positive comment doesn't address what happens when the bottler changes to synthetic "corks." The screw enters as usual but when you attempt to push down on the wings the bottle starts spinning. The solution is to hold the wings and the neck of the bottle (contortionists please apply) and press the wings until the "cork" comes out. This one was designed for real corks and if your bottles always have such you'll be quite happy with the Metrokane.
